Question
(a) The speed of light inside a material is 1.7 x 108 m/s. What is the refractive index
of this material.
(b) A light ray traveling in air strikes the surface of a piece of glass of refractive
index 1.55, making an angle of 75° with the normal. At what angle it will refract
inside the glass.
(c) A light ray traveling in water of refractive index 1.33, strikes a piece of glass of
refractive index 1.51, making certain angle i with normal. If the angle of
refraction is 35°, find the angle of incidence i ?
(d) You are passing by a small pool full of a clear liquid. You don’t know if
the liquid is water or something else. You checked that the apparent depth of the
pool is 4 m. You jumped inside the pool and found that the real depth of the pool
is 6 m. What is the index of refraction of the liquid inside the pool? Using table
23.1 in the textbook and find what liquid is there in the pool.
Explanation / Answer
( a )
From the definition of refractive index,n
n = c / V
Here, c is speed of light
n = 3 x108 m/s / 1.7 x 108 m/s = 1.764
------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Use Snell's law
n1 sin 1 = n2 sin2
( 1 ) sin 75° = ( 1.55 ) sin2
Solve for 2
2 = 38.54o
------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Use Snell's law
n1 sin 1 = n2 sin2
( 1.33 ) sin 1 = ( 1.51 ) sin35o
Solve for 1
1 = 40.6o
